Cocalero Grasshopper

Ingredients

  • 1 oz Cocalero
  • 1 oz Creme de cacao white
  • 1 oz Heavy cream

Instructions

  • Add all ingredients into a cocktail shaker with ice.
  • Shake for 10 sec.
  • Strain into your favorite cocktail glass and enjoy
  • You can add a mint sprig as garnish

Bedlam Vodka is distilled in Durham, North Carolina, from rice, which makes it gluten-free and adds a smooth finish that you don’t normally get from other Vodkas.

Christmas in Rio

Christmas in Rio was made for the staycation lovers out there. This little holiday getaway-in-a-glass will have you feeling like Santa in a bikini! Eat, drink, & cran-freakin-merry!
Prep Time3 minutes
Active Time0 minutes
Course: Drinks
Yield: 1 Drink
Cost: $2

Materials

  • 10 Cranberries Fresh Cranberries
  • .5 oz Lime, quartered & muddled (1/2oz lime juice)
  • .75 oz Demerara syrup (2:1 Sugar in the Raw : water)
  • 1.5 oz Grand Marnier
  • 1.5 oz Bedlam Vodka  

Instructions

  • Muddle Cranberries, then lime in the bottom of a cocktail shaker. Add remaining ingredients with ice and shake till sufficiently chilled. Pour all contents into a rocks glass and Enjoy.

Winter Soul

A twist on an Old Fashioned and adaptation of Bedlam's signature Old Soul.Think you can find a classier cocktail to sip sitting in your winged armchair in your library filled with leather bound books and the smell of rich mahogany? Fig-Get about it.
Prep Time3 minutes
Cook Time0 minutes
Course: Drinks
Servings: 1 Drink
Cost: $2

Ingredients

  • 4 Dash "Sycophant" Crude Bitters
  • 1 Dash Fee Brothers Black walnut bitters
  • .25 oz Fig Syrup
  • 2.5 oz Bedlam Vodka

Instructions

  • Add all ingredients to an old-fashioned glass with ice and stir till sufficiently chilled. Express lemon peel over the drink.

Pornstar Martini Cocktail

Equipment

  • Paring knife
  • cocktail strainer
  • Fine strainer
  • Chilled martini or coupe glass
  • Shot glass

Ingredients

  • 1.5 whole Passion fruit
  • 2 oz Vodka
  • .5 oz Passoa Liqueur
  • .5 oz simple syrup
  • 2 oz Brut Champagne chilled
  • .5 tbsp vanilla extract
  • .5 whole passion fruit for garnish

Instructions

  • Cut two passion fruits in half. Scoop our insides of 3 halves into a cocktail shaker. Save the 4th half for garnish.
  • Add the vodka, passoa liqueur, simple syrup, and vanilla extract to the shaker.
  • Fill with ice and shake extremely vigorously. You want to create a nice foam layer when you pour.
  • Use a fine strainer to pour into your glass. Gently float the 4th half of passion fruit in the glass, cut side up.
  • Pour a small glass with champagne.
  • Alternate sips between glasses.

E&J Brandy Ritz & Glitz

For the Champagne With A Twist Lover
Perfect for the friend who loves to celebrate the New Year with champagne but wants a twist, the Ritzand Glitz is a delicious cocktail that combines champagne with the most popular American brandy, E&J Brandy
Prep Time3 minutes
Active Time5 minutes
Course: Drinks
Yield: 1 Drink
Cost: $2

Materials

  • 1.5 oz E&J Brandy VSOP
  • .5 oz Fresh Lemon Juice
  • 1 Splash LaMarca Prosecco Top with Prosecoo
  • 1 Lemon Garnish with a Lemon Peel

Instructions

  • Combine brandy and fresh lemon juice into a champagne flute or highball glass, top with champagne and stir lightly. Garnish with a lemon peel.

Camarena Old Fashioned

For the Friend Who Likes the Classics
For the classic friend who's ready to turn up for New Year's - Camarena, the most awarded tequila, mixes wonderfully into any cocktail, but try it in an old fashioned for a fun twist on a classic.






Prep Time3 minutes
Cook Time0 minutes
Course: Drinks
Servings: 1 Drink
Cost: $2

Ingredients

  • 2 oz Camarena Reposado
  • .5 oz Agave Nectar
  • 2 Dashes Bitters

Instructions

  • Place your ingredients into a glass filled with ice and stir to mix the ingredients. Garnish with orange peel.

Coconut Drop at Midnight

For the Friend who Likes to Keep it Fresh
RumHaven is the perfect light and refreshing spirit to keep the party going all night long.Round out your holiday celebrations and kick-off 2021 with the fizzy and freshCoconut Drop at Midnight to head into the new year on the right foot.
 
Prep Time3 minutes
Cook Time0 minutes
Course: Drinks
Servings: 1 Drink
Cost: $2

Ingredients

  • 2 oz RumHaven
  • .5 oz Fresh Lime Juice
  • 2 oz Prosecco add a splash of prosecco

Instructions

  • Combine all ingredients in champagne glasses. Top with prosecco and garnish with a lime peel.
